Batman Arkham Origins Plotline Detailed, The Bad Guys Revealed

Batman Arkham Origins contains a lot of villains, and we already know about Deathstroke via the GameInformer cover but there are more in the game.

According to promotional materials spotted on CVG, we have some details on more criminals that you will be fighting or seeing in the game.

This is a prequel to all the Batman games released so far on the PS3, Xbox 360, and PC, so some of the names shouldn’t be shocking because of what happened to them in these games.

There are more criminals like Joker, Bane, Killer Croc, Scarecrow and Deadshot. Batman will be young and inexperienced in the game so he could get his ass kicked.

The game will show Batman’s young years and his relationship with his butler. The developer diary posted on GameInformer gives us more details on the game.

“We wanted to take a look at the Batman and Alfred relationship a different way, to make it more relatable,” said Dooma Wendschuh, the game’s narrative director

“Batman sees Alfred as an extension of the darkest time, the darkest thing in his life. He sees Alfred as an extension of the death of his parents, because Alfred’s been around since his parents were around. Sort of as an overbearing parental figure. And Alfred, for his part, sees Batman as this spoiled kid who’s squandering his parents’ wealth on these nightly escapades. The two of them clash often throughout our story.”

You can see the whole video here. It will be out this October for all the current gen platforms including the Wii U.
